Understanding Temporal Mechanics
Temporal mechanics is the field of study that explores the theoretical principles behind time travel. It involves understanding the nature of time, causality, paradoxes, and the potential consequences of altering past events.
Theories of Time Travel
Various theories have been proposed to explain how time travel could be possible. These include the concept of wormholes, time dilation through relativistic effects, and the idea of closed timelike curves that could allow for backward time travel.
Wormholes
Wormholes are hypothetical tunnels in spacetime that could create shortcuts for traveling between different points in time and space. While wormholes remain speculative, they are a popular concept in science fiction.
Time Dilation
According to Einstein's theory of relativity, time can be experienced differently for observers moving at different speeds. This effect, known as time dilation, suggests that time travel to the future could be possible by traveling at near-light speeds.
Closed Timelike Curves
Closed timelike curves are paths in spacetime that loop back on themselves, potentially allowing for time loops or travel to the past. The existence of closed timelike curves raises questions about causality and the possibility of changing past events.
Paradoxes and Consequences
Time travel raises intriguing paradoxes such as the grandfather paradox, where a time traveler could potentially prevent their own existence by altering past events. The study of temporal mechanics also considers the ethical and philosophical implications of time travel, including the concept of a fixed timeline versus a multiverse of branching timelines.
